Pay Attention to Calories

I hate to bring this up but it is still a basic truth to losing weight. You must consume less calories than you burn. It is important not to deprive yourself of food, this will only lead to binging. It does mean you need to control portions.

Stay Positive

Having a positive outlook on life can increase your likelihood for success. Those who remain light-hearted and maintain a positive attitude are more successful at losing weight than those who are pessimistic.

In addition, being happy has been correlated with a stronger immune system. Being happy can make you more resistant to disease and illness.
